2001 BMW Z8 Problems

 

Distortion of front shock towers caused by hitting a pothole

Verified for the BMW Z8
If the vehicle hits a pothole, distortion to the front shock towers can occur. The problem may be attributed to the run-flat tires. BMW has released a performance package upgrade for the front suspension, which includes a steel strut brace, steel strut mounts, and steel reinforcement plates for the top of the strut towers. This will help prevent damage to the frame.
